If you want some pointers I'd be glad to share some thoughts. Here's a few thoughts ro start
In my experience, Our trucks and trailers in stock form are not scale. And not width to height to length. Additionally, getting stock or aftermarket suspension systems tends to be the lesser cost avenue. Styrene is good, I like .08. Has good body and yet not too thick. Balsa is a good choice too. It really depends on what you want to do with the trailer - how much abuse. |
